π Average CRNA Salary in 2024
π° $254,636 per year (Base salary + bonuses)
This data comes from real CRNAs in the latest salary and employment survey.
π Salary Trends Over Time
- Steady growth despite economic changes
- 36% of CRNAs saw pay cuts in recent years due to the pandemic
- High demand means facilities are competing for CRNAs, driving up pay

π₯ Where Do CRNAs Work?
In 2023, most CRNAs worked in:
π¨ Hospitals: 48%
π’ Medical Group Owned by a Hospital: 20%
π₯ Independent Medical Group / Private Practice: 25%

π§ββοΈ Who Are Todayβs CRNAs?
π¨ββοΈ Male: 43%
π©ββοΈ Female: 55%
π Prefer Not to Say: 2%
π Work Preferences & Experience:
- 70% of CRNAs prefer contract or locum tenens work
- 37% have been practicing 21+ years
